Abstract

A flat touch-and-close fastener element, which is detachably connected to a second touch-and-close fastener element, thereby forms a touch-and-close closure. The fastener element has a system of threads ( 10 ) of warp and weft threads, as well as pile threads. The individual threads have different chemical and/or physical properties and, for this purpose, are formed of different materials.

The invention claimed is: 
     
       1. A flat touch-and-close fastener element connectable to another touch-and-close fastener element to form a releasable touch-and-close fastener, the flat touch-and-close fastener element comprising:
 a thread system having warp threads, weft threads, and pile threads, individual ones of said warp threads, weft threads or pile threads having different chemical or physical properties provided by the individual ones of the warp threads, weft threads or pile threads being formed of different materials, said weft threads extending over a long thread path as longer weft threads within said thread system being formed of polyamide, said weft threads extending over a shorter thread path as shorter partial weft threads being formed of polyester. 
 
     
     
       2. A touch-and-close fastener element according to  claim 1  wherein
 said warp threads are formed of polyester; and 
 at least parts of said pile threads are formed of polyamide. 
 
     
     
       3. A touch-and-close fastener element according to  claim 1  wherein
 parts of said pile threads are formed of polyester; and 
 other parts of said pile threads are formed of polyamide. 
 
     
     
       4. A touch-and-close fastener element according to  claim 1  wherein
 a partial weft fiber is incorporated into a weave pattern of said thread system for each warp thread course with two of said pile threads being followed by four warp thread courses, said weave pattern restarting beginning with one of said shorter partial weft threads. 
 
     
     
       5. A touch-and-close fastener element according to  claim 1  wherein
 each of said threads of said thread system are made of multifilaments. 
 
     
     
       6. A touch-and-close fastener element according to  claim 1  wherein
 said thread system is a Raschel knit. 
 
     
     
       7. A touch-and-close fastener element according to  claim 1  wherein
 said thread system has a finish thereon. 
 
     
     
       8. A touch-and-close fastener element according to  claim 7  wherein
 said finish comprises a polyurethane material on a side of said thread system facing away from said pile threads. 
 
     
     
       9. A touch-and-close fastener element according to  claim 1  wherein
 said thread system comprises at least one of flame retardant linear elements, electrically conductive linear elements, thermally conductive linear elements or strength value increasing linear elements in addition to said warp threads, said weft threads and said pile threads.
